Output 8e5ea63cfcab59583edaa1ec5cfec20e0ed8a1ec6d92271ac84f6b00009a5182:1

value
109481060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1907ebc35d1067d4d46db2ce219af2b87705539d OP_EQUAL
address
MABWcan6JZKwqLcZbJkdcvJ35ovCDd4bSp
transaction
8e5ea63cfcab59583edaa1ec5cfec20e0ed8a1ec6d92271ac84f6b00009a5182
spent
true